An intern with the Pensacola Blue Wahoos will learn in an organization and environment recognized as one of the best in minor-league baseball. The Blue Wahoos goal is to provide each intern with a valuable learning experience while the college or university course requirements are met. Interns are unpaid students, and they must be part of a college or university program or course. 


Essential Duties and Responsibilities (with an emphasis on education) 

-Learn inventorying of merchandise  
-Assist with maintenance of retail locations, make them eye appealing and organized 
-Train to, and maintains retail standards, policies and procedures  
-Learn to open and close retail locations  
-Assist retail management with the daily cash procedures and operations 
-Monitor store floor, assist with guests needs and requests 
-Co-supervise retail associates; completes store operational needs by assigning employees and following up on work results 
-Regularly evaluate, create, and maintain professional visual displays; provide direction to retail associates regarding store merchandising and displays  
-Ensure integrity of physical inventory and par levels  
-Maintain cleanliness and safety standards throughout the retail shops 
-Attend Wahoos U training program to gain knowledge and professional development 
-Other duties as assigned
